摘要
A series of extended model thiophene oligomers (nT) have been oxidized in dilute solution by stoichiometric amounts of FeCl3. The respective radical cations nT+. (polarons) are quantitatively generated in the first step of the chemical process, as evidenced by in-situ optical absorption and ESR spectroscopies. The 6T+. radical cation salt of the hexamer precipitates as a highly stable, paramagnetic and conducting solid. In the second step of the oxidation, 6T+. is interconverted into the 6T++ dication (bipolaron). These unambiguous results, obtained on well-defined and non-interacting systems, are discussed in terms of discrete MO-levels and evidence the role of disorder and three-dimensional effects in the electronic properties of doped polythiophene.
